Government to compensate for damage caused by hail

The Kosovo government today has approved the decision to immediately compensate for damage caused this year by the hail in Kosovo municipalities. Also, the decision has authorised the Ministry of Finance to launch procedures to create a special fund for compensation of eventual damage to the agriculture sector during 2019. Under preparations for establishing this fund, the Government has also decided to establish a working group for establishing the agricultural product insurance system.

Kosovo Prime Minister Ramush Haradinaj, except that he has said farmers will be compensated, has asked the Ministry of Agriculture not to stop subsidies for these farmers. As for the budget for compensation of these farmers, Finance Minister Bedri Hamza has said the means will be found and the damages will be compensated, but he said that with the level they have as real opportunities as a state. Meanwhile, in terms of the establishment of a special fund for 2019, Hamza was the one proposing that as a longer-term solution a task force be established for establishing the agricultural insurance system. While Deputy Agriculture Minister Mevludin Krasniqi submitted the only four municipalities' demand for compensation, amounting to 6.7m euros. Krasniqi: Drenas, Rahoveci, Ferizaj and Lipjan, their demands are 6.7m euros.

The Kosovo government at this meeting has made a decision to establish a commission that will deal with preparing the proposal for the selection of fire status in Kosovo. The commission will be guided by a representative of the Prime Minister's Office and in composition with representatives from the Ministry of Internal Affairs, the Ministry of Management of Local Power, the Ministry of Finance, the Ministry of Justice, the European Integrity, the Ministry of Public Administration, the Emergency Management Agency, Kosovo Police and the Kosovo Commission Association. Prime Minister Ramush Haradinaj said this establishment of this commission is important as it will define the status of firefighters in Kosovo the Kosovo government has also approved the six-month budget report for 2018, which will be sent to the Kosovo Assembly.

Finance Minister Bedri Hamza, who submitted this report, said the report for this period proves total revenues in the amount of 870m euros. Today's meeting has also approved the decision to establish Task Force for Environmental Cleaning, this Task Force will handle campaign organisation and action “to clear Kosovo” from September 15th to December 15th 2018. The Kosovo government has continued its mandate for three years, chief executive of the Kosovo Forest Agency under the Ministry of Agriculture, Forestry and Rural Development. While the candidates for the chairmanship of the Energy Regulatory Office Board have also been nominated, where Fadil Ismaili, Petit Pepaj, Kabashi Progress, and Bekim Jakupi are on the list.

This list of candidates will be prosecuted in the Kosovo Assembly, which will make the selection of the board chairman of the Energy Regulatory Office. The Government's approval at today's meeting has also received the draft for ratification of the loan agreement between the Republic of Kosovo and the European Investment Bank for the Pristina-Peje Highway project, the Kijevo-Zahq segment. The signed agreement provides the Republic of Kosovo a loan in the amount of 80m euros, which will be used to implement the Pristina-Peje highway Project, the Kijevo-Zhaq segment, Kosova Prees reports.
